Transaction 561edec76a581ffcd458e143aedff4ad690a400a09ac066eb426ab263adfce8d

1 Input
1 Outputs
  • 561edec76a581ffcd458e143aedff4ad690a400a09ac066eb426ab263adfce8d:0
  • value  1100175
    address  34BKzdRCZefb4bAHFExAx9XfmrfSpRvxem